Transaction 72f78e3669b86afdd725fa13f5eaa05e93a77b249ad2321e1e40e5639e53d943

1 Input
2 Outputs
  • 72f78e3669b86afdd725fa13f5eaa05e93a77b249ad2321e1e40e5639e53d943:0
  • value  2000000
    address  1MCFdm5QEocDr82nAjA3y7WZBitWpyv6BM
  • 72f78e3669b86afdd725fa13f5eaa05e93a77b249ad2321e1e40e5639e53d943:1
  • value  426000000
    address  14FbwgFjLJPAFYjHY1RehBBqHv128cUBTR